TVS Holdings and TVS Motor execute succession plan with aligned ownership

TVS Holdings and TVS Motor Company have started a perfect transition on property, reinforcing their succession plan.

Sudarshan Venu, currently Managing Director of TVS Motor, has now become a significant beneficial owner, in accordance with a business registrar presentation (ROC) dated April 23, 2025.

The filling, accessed by Business lineConfirms a transfer between s among the promoters. As a result, both Venu Srinivasan and his son South Aarshan Venu now appear as “people who act in concert” and “significant beneficial owners.” This movement aligns leadership with property, marking a new phase in the governance of TVS Motor.

In compliance with section 90 of the Law of Companies, 2013, and the relevant rules, the industrial Venu Srinivasan and Sudarshan Venu have formally declared their important beneficial property in TVS Holdings Limited, part of the largest group of televisions.

According to Form No. Ben-1, both people revealed their substantial indirect holdings in the company through trusts in which they serve as a trustee.

The presentations reveal that Venu Srinivasan, a key promoter of TVS Holdings, has 63.80 percent beneficial interest in the company through vs. Trust, where he serves as administrator. Their indirect rights include the property of shares, voting rights and the right to dividends. In addition, it has a 3.07 percent participation through Srinivasan Trust, also as a trustee.

Sudarshan Venu, also VS Trust’s truster, declared the same indirect possession of 63.80 percent, along with a 3.07 percent participation through Srinivasan Trust.

The presentations highlight that Venu Srinivasan and Sudarshan Venu are acting together, a fact indicated in the official documentation. This is aligned with government norms that require public statements or significant influence or control in corporate entities.

Such changes are part of a broader realignment within the family of extended televisions. On March 18, 2025, it was reported that the property and management response through televisions and tractors and agricultural equipment LTD (TAFE) were being reorganized, after the appointment of Lakshmi Venu as Vice 1725.

The movements follow a memorandum of understanding signed in March 2024 by Venu Srinivasan and his family, with the aim of minimizing competition between families and guaranteeing the continuity of the business.

The coordinated transition between the children of Venu Srinivasan and Mallika Srinivasan underlines the smooth and strategic execution of succession planning within the TVS group.
